Use Micorsoft DI framework to replace current Dictionary<,> based service registration.
This is basically identical to my previous #264. Compared to option 1 #285, this is a relatively conservative change. It's up to you to make a choice.
In this change ApiConfiguration has its service registration/resolve built upon MS.FX.DI, almost all public interfaces remain same.
There's 1 major breaking change:
Services or hook handlers can't be resolved before ApiConfiguraion committed.

Personally I like option 1 more, IMO it's cleaner, more componentized, and the building pattern mimics what's in ASP.NET MVC.
